Hi all,

This patchset enables >0 order folio memory compaction, which is one of
the prerequisitions for large folio support[1]. It is on top of
mm-everything-2024-01-18-22-21.

I am aware of that split free pages is necessary for folio
migration in compaction, since if >0 order free pages are never split
and no order-0 free page is scanned, compaction will end prematurely due
to migration returns -ENOMEM. Free page split becomes a must instead of
an optimization.

Overall, I haven't found any obvious issues, thanks for your work. However I got some percentage regression when running thpcompact on my machine(16 cores and 120G memory) without enabling mTHP:
k6.8-rc1 k6.8-rc1-patched
Percentage huge-1 86.19 ( 0.00%) 51.17 ( -40.63%)
Percentage huge-3 93.64 ( 0.00%) 42.48 ( -54.64%)
Percentage huge-5 94.93 ( 0.00%) 31.06 ( -67.28%)
Percentage huge-7 95.40 ( 0.00%) 19.09 ( -79.99%)
Percentage huge-12 93.51 ( 0.00%) 32.06 ( -65.71%)
Percentage huge-18 83.02 ( 0.00%) 54.58 ( -34.26%)
Percentage huge-24 83.17 ( 0.00%) 49.61 ( -40.35%)
Percentage huge-30 96.69 ( 0.00%) 59.82 ( -38.13%)
Percentage huge-32 95.52 ( 0.00%) 59.20 ( -38.03%)

Ops Compaction stalls 229710.00 554846.00
Ops Compaction success 144177.00 9351.00
Ops Compaction failures 85533.00 545495.00
Ops Compaction efficiency 62.76 1.69
Ops Page migrate success 60333689.00 11687573.00
Ops Page migrate failure 25818.00 459621.00
Ops Compaction pages isolated 127723211.00 224420997.00
Ops Compaction migrate scanned 142498744.00 173345194.00
Ops Compaction free scanned 1159752360.00 624633726.00
Ops Compact scan efficiency 12.29 27.75
Ops Compaction cost 66050.96 17615.55

I did not have time to analyze this issue, just providing you some test information. And I will measure the compaction efficiency of mTHP if I find some time.

From RFC [1]:
1. Enabled >0 order folio compaction in the first patch by splitting all
to-be-migrated folios. (per Huang, Ying)

2. Stopped isolating compound pages with order greater than cc->order
to avoid wasting effort, since cc->order gives a hint that no free pages
with order greater than it exist, thus migrating the compound pages will fail.
(per Baolin Wang)

3. Retained the folio check within lru lock. (per Baolin Wang)

4. Made isolate_freepages_block() generate order-sorted multi lists.
(per Johannes Weiner)

Overview
===

To support >0 order folio compaction, the patchset changes how free pages used
for migration are kept during compaction. Free pages used to be split into
order-0 pages that are post allocation processed (i.e., PageBuddy flag cleared,
page order stored in page->private is zeroed, and page reference is set to 1).
Now all free pages are kept in a MAX_ORDER+1 array of page lists based
on their order without post allocation process. When migrate_pages() asks for
a new page, one of the free pages, based on the requested page order, is
then processed and given out.
